Mim Lloyd Posted January 24 #3 Share Posted January 24 (edited) I live in Liverpool. Chester is easy to get to from Liverpool by train. The cruise terminal isn't far from James Street station where you can get a direct train to Chester. There are many trains throughout the day, the journey time is just under an hour and costs from £7. And if you live in the UK and are of pensionable age with a travel pass, it's free!
